首页 >>  正文

c语言怎么输入字符串

来源:baiyundou.net   日期:2024-08-23

云萧林2077c语言中如何输入输出字符串 -
巫熊环18434981466 ______ puts()和gets()都是数组函数,输入或输出前要定义数组 例如: char a[50]; gets(a); puts(a); 就是一个简单的输入后再将输入的东西输出,puts()的输入和printf的输出是有一定的区别的,puts()遇到'\0'就终止,而用printf则不会这样. 例如: char a[50]; gets(a); puts(a); printf("%s",a); 如果正好输入50个字符,则两次输出一致.但如果输入字符不足50个,puts()输出输入的全部字符,而没有输入的不输出,而printf则不能识别'\0',所以会出现乱码.

云萧林2077c语言怎么输入多个字符串 -
巫熊环18434981466 ______ char str1[20],str2[20]; scanf("%s%s",str1,str2); 这样就可以实现多个字符串的输入,注意几点: 1. 输入的每一个字符串长度应小于定义时的字符数组长度. 2. 输入字符串时,字符串与字符串之间用空格符或者回车换行符隔开.

云萧林2077c语言中如何向数组中输入字符串并输出这个字符串 -
巫熊环18434981466 ______ #includeint mian(){ char a[100]; scanf("%s",a); \/\/键盘输入字符串 printf("%s",a);\/\/控制台输出字符串 return 0;}

云萧林2077c语言怎么输入一个字符串,并赋给字符指针 -
巫熊环18434981466 ______ int main() { char *p = (char *)malloc(21); fgets(p,20,stdin); printf("p:%s\n",p); free(p); return 0; }

云萧林2077c语言中函数里面怎么输入字符串数组 -
巫熊环18434981466 ______ 在C语言中,字符串是以字符数组方式保存的,于是字符串数组可以用二维字符数组存储. 输入时,每次输入字符串数组的一个元素(一行),根据需要,使用scanf或gets进行输入. 如: char str[10][100]; //定义字符串数组,供10行,每行最多100个字节数据. int i; for(i = 0; i < 10; i ++) scanf("%s",str[i]);//输入10行字符串数据.

云萧林2077c语言在编译时要求输入若干个字符串该怎么输入???? -
巫熊环18434981466 ______ 声明数组时不必规定长度,默认为第一次输入时的长度

云萧林2077C语言中字符串是怎么输出,输入的?举个列子 -
巫熊环18434981466 ______ #include <stdio.h> int main{ char *string = “helloworld”; printf("%s\n",string); return 0; }

云萧林2077如何在C语言里用循环语句输入字符串 -
巫熊环18434981466 ______ int szText[10]; for(int i=0; i <10; i++) { scanf("%c", &szText[i]); }

云萧林2077在c语言中,如何从键盘输入一串包含数字和字母的字符串,以连续的数字构成一 -
巫熊环18434981466 ______ #include void count(char *p,int *numCount,int *EnCount,int *FuhaoCount) { while(*p !=0) { if(*p>='0' && *p (*numCount)++; else if((*p>='a' && *p='A' && *p (*EnCount)++; else (*FuhaoCount)++; p++; } } void main(){ char ch[30]; int a = 0,b = 0 ,c = 0; ...

云萧林2077C语言上中怎么样直接输入输出一个字符串 -
巫熊环18434981466 ______ 利用输出控制符%s,比如定义一个数组存放,char a[10];但是输出的时...

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024